摘要

Theluminescence spectra of a low-temperature plasma of a pulse-periodic discharge in a He-Glu mixture at low pressures not exceeding several tens of Torr have been experimentally studied for the first time. In the spectral range of 200-850 nm, there are intense UVb ands of the obtained fragments of glutamine mol- ecules, namely, nitrogen molecules N-2* (C-3 Pi(u) -> B-3 Pi(g)), and emission bands of carbon monoxides CO* (B-1 Sigma -> A(1)Pi) in the visible and infrared regions. The highest luminescence yield of molecules of glutamine fragments is achieved at a temperature of the gas-discharge tube wall not exceeding 140 degrees C.
